What is a Machine Learning NLP job?

A Machine Learning NLP job involves developing algorithms and models that enable machines to understand, process, and generate human language. Professionals in this role work with large datasets, train models on text data, and fine-tune natural language processing techniques such as sentiment analysis, text classification, and language translation. They often use machine learning frameworks like TensorFlow, PyTorch, and NLP libraries such as spaCy or Hugging Face Transformers. The goal is to build intelligent applications, including chatbots, search engines, and automated content analysis systems.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Machine Learning NLP specialist?

As a Machine Learning NLP specialist, your daily responsibilities often include designing and implementing NLP models, cleaning and preprocessing large text datasets, and experimenting with algorithms to improve model performance. You may also evaluate model results, collaborate with software engineers and data scientists, and stay updated on the latest research in the field. Frequent code reviews, participation in team meetings, and contributing to documentation are also common. This role combines hands-on technical work with collaborative problem-solving to develop language-based AI solutions for real-world applications.

Job description

Job Summary:
HCLTech is looking for an experienced AI/ML Engineer / Data Scientist to design, develop, and deploy advanced machine learning and data science solutions. The ideal candidate will have expertise in predictive modeling, deep learning, NLP, and large-scale data analytics, with hands-on experience building end-to-end ML workflows.
Responsibilities:
• Design, develop, and deploy machine learning and advanced analytics solutions for business use cases.
• Gather, analyze, and transform structured and unstructured data to support data-driven decision-making.
• Build and optimize predictive models using machine learning, deep learning, and statistical techniques.
• Develop sequence-based models using RNNs, LSTMs, Transformers, and related architectures.
• Analyze high-volume clickstream and session-level data to derive actionable insights.
• Select appropriate modeling techniques based on data characteristics, business requirements, and performance objectives.
• Develop and maintain scalable ML workflows and model pipelines.
• Implement NLP and text analytics solutions using modern libraries and frameworks.
• Monitor, govern, and maintain machine learning models throughout their lifecycle.
• Collaborate with business stakeholders, data engineers, and cross-functional teams to deliver analytical solutions.
• Write high-quality, reusable, and well-tested code following software engineering best practices.
• Build dashboards, visualizations, or GUI-based interfaces as needed to support business users.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related field.
• 6+ years of experience in Data Science, Machine Learning, or Artificial Intelligence.
• Strong programming experience in Python, R, and SQL.
• Experience with machine learning algorithms including: XGBoost, Decision Trees, Random Forests, Logistic Regression, Support Vector Machines (SVM), Gradient Boosting, Bayesian Networks, Clustering Algorithms, Dimensionality Reduction Techniques.
• Experience developing sequence models using RNNs, LSTMs, and Transformers.
• Hands-on experience with TensorFlow, Keras, and/or PyTorch.
• Strong knowledge of Natural Language Processing (NLP) and Text Analytics.
• Experience with NLP libraries such as NLTK and SpaCy.
• Experience building and managing end-to-end ML workflows.
• Strong knowledge of Python data science libraries including: NumPy, SciPy, Scikit-learn.
• Experience in model deployment, governance, monitoring, and maintenance.
•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
Preferred:
• Experience with Data Science platforms such as Dataiku, H2O, Azure ML, or similar.
• Experience with cloud platforms including AWS, Azure, or GCP.
• Knowledge of Big Data technologies such as: Hadoop, Hive/HQL, HDFS, Spark/PySpark, Kafka.
• Experience with version control tools such as Git, GitHub, GitLab, SVN, or Mercurial.
• Experience building session-level analytics and clickstream models.
• Experience working in Agile development environments.
• Familiarity with MLOps and production-grade machine learning deployments.
• Ability to design scalable, enterprise-level AI and analytics solutions.
